XmCommandSetValue(library call) XmCommandSetValue(library call)NAMEXmCommandSetValue -- A Command function that replaces a displayed stringSYNOPSIS#include <Xm/Command.h> void XmCommandSetValue( Widget widget, XmString command);DESCRIPTIONXmCommandSetValue replaces the string displayed in the command area of the Command widget with the passed XmString. widget Specifies the Command widget ID command Specifies the passed XmString For a complete definition of Command and its associated resources, see XmCommand(3).RELATEDXmCommand(3).
